GENERAL POWER OF ATTORNEY

A general power of attorney is a legal document that grants an individual the authority to act on behalf of another person in a wide range of personal and financial matters. This authority can include managing bank accounts, signing checks, handling real estate transactions, and making healthcare decisions. The person who grants this power is known as the principal, while the appointed individual is referred to as the agent or attorney-in-fact. This arrangement can simplify decision-making processes and ensure that the principal's interests are represented even when they are unable to perform these tasks themselves. It's important to note that the powers granted under a general power of attorney can be broad, so careful consideration should be given to whom these powers are entrusted. Legal advice is often recommended to ensure that the document meets all necessary requirements and reflects the principal's wishes accurately.
